Padres shut down Nationals
The San Diego Padres scored five runs in the fifth inning en route to a 7-0 win over the Washington Nationals and earned a sweep of the three-game series at Petco Park.
San Diego won the game as -125 favorites, and the team’s played UNDER the posted over/under (7.5).
Chase Headley and Adrian Gonzalez drove in a pair of runs for the Padres. Kevin Correia pitched a three-hit shutout through 7 2-3 innings for the win.
John Lannan was rocked for five runs in suffering the loss on the hill for Washington.
